Incentive Products Market....Very Big
| The Incentive Research Foundation and arch-nemesis organization the Incentive Federation have collaborated on a joint survey of the incentive market. According to their study, companies spent $32.7 billion on merchandise incentives and $13.4 billion on incentive travel. I hope they put their logo on some of that stuff! 34% of companies claim to use incentives, 30% claimed their budgets grew in the last 2 years and 59% say their incentive budget will increase over the next 2 years.
